JAPAN: Sapporo Holdings to purchase outstanding Pokka shares
By just-drinks.com editorial team | 10 February 2011
Sapporo Holdings has confirmed reports this week that it hopes to acquire all outstanding shares in fellow Japanese food and drink group Pokka.
